Sdílet prostřednictvím


DECLARE_REGISTRY_RESOURCEID

Stejné jako DECLARE_REGISTRY_RESOURCE , použije Průvodce generované UINT prostředku než název řetězce.

DECLARE_REGISTRY_RESOURCEID( 
   x  
)

Parametry

  • x
    [v] Průvodce generovaný identifikátor prostředku.

Poznámky

Při vytváření objektu nebo řídit pomocí Průvodce projektu ATL, průvodce automaticky implementovat podporu skriptem registru a přidat DECLARE_REGISTRY_RESOURCEID makro k souborům.

Staticky můžete propojit s komponentou registru ATL (Registrar) pro přístup k optimalizaci registru.Staticky odkaz kód registrátor, přidejte následující řádek do souboru stdafx.h:

#define _ATL_STATIC_REGISTRY

Jestliže chcete nahradit náhradní hodnoty v době spuštění ATL, nezadávejte DECLARE_REGISTRY_RESOURCE nebo DECLARE_REGISTRY_RESOURCEID makro.Místo toho vytvořte pole _ATL_REGMAP_ENTRIES struktury, kde každá položka obsahuje zástupný symbol proměnné spárována s hodnotou nahraďte zástupný symbol v době spuštění.Potom voláním CAtlModule::UpdateRegistryFromResourceD nebo CAtlModule::UpdateRegistryFromResourceS, předáním pole.Přidá všechny náhradní hodnoty v _ATL_REGMAP_ENTRIES struktury tajemníka náhradní mapy.

Další informace o skriptování a nahraditelných parametrů naleznete v článku Registru komponent ATL (Registrar).

Požadavky

Záhlaví: atlcom.h

Viz také

Referenční dokumentace

DECLARE_REGISTRY

DECLARE_REGISTRY_RESOURCE

Další zdroje

Makra v registru

Makra ATL